Zishu Qu (屈子舒) has been competing for 12 years. His best event is the 3×3: a personal-best single of 12.57, set at Xi'an Cherry Blossom 2014, puts him in the top 15.9% of the 284,439 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 6,238th in China. Across 6 competitions since April 2014, he has put 183 official solves on the record across eight events. Solve to solve, his 3×3 times vary about 12% around a typical one, steadier than 80% of the 35,811 competitors with ten or more counted rounds. Zishu has entered six competitions, more competitions than 86% of everyone who has ever competed.

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
